Rotated signing key for Squatterhawk, our typo-squatting package scanner. Old key expired per the quarterly schedule. Scanner binaries built after build 4410 are signed with the new key; older artifacts remain verifiable against the archived key in the Bramblevault. CI verification updated, mirror nodes in the Ketterby cluster refreshed. No action needed unless you self-host verification — if so, update your trust store with the key below.

deploy key for kajof-fajop: bky6_gDHw9Q

Subject: Vantor Launch — Plan Locked

Team,

Vantor launches in six weeks. Branch managers get stock allocations Friday; demo kits ship the week after. Training is mandatory — two sessions, no exceptions. Pricing holds at the approved tier until the post-launch review. Press embargo lifts on launch morning only. Escalate supply gaps to Dario's desk immediately. Direction on the follow-on phase is below.

management briefing: The renewal with Zoraelax Group closes at $10 million a year, 15 percent below the last contract. Project Ralael slips by six weeks because of the audit delay.

The garage occupancy feed for the Brindlewood campus arrives over a message queue every thirty seconds, one record per level, published by the Stallgrid edge boxes. Counts can briefly go negative when a sensor double-fires on exit; the ingest job clamps these to zero and flags the interval. If the feed stalls for more than five minutes, the dashboard falls back to the last known snapshot. Sensor mappings, queue names, and the replay procedure are documented on the internal page below.

runbook for tahog-kadug: https://gitlab.qirvanworks.corp/projects/pages/view/b139298aed28

**Ticket: Staging env misconfigured after Fernpipe broker upgrade**

While upgrading the Fernpipe broker from 3.x to 4.x on the Oakhurst staging cluster, the old `.env` was copied over without updating connection settings. Consumers are failing handshake because `BROKER_PROTOCOL_VERSION` still reads `3`. Set it to `4`, confirm `BROKER_HEARTBEAT_SECONDS=20`, and restart the worker pool. The new broker also requires authenticated connections, so place the broker credential on the line immediately after this note.

env line for fafof-fahag: LEDGER_TOKEN5=f8790